Output 66753f0761f2e23183c29af563d0f6af9e5ffa04141e1884d864ecef938b7910:56

value
2980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91448381630fdd999bd97da5f9f2841762c4012a OP_EQUALVERIFY OP_CHECKSIG
address
1EF74EMbG8BNHgZEtgiQaHckE4YG9KGcU8
transaction
66753f0761f2e23183c29af563d0f6af9e5ffa04141e1884d864ecef938b7910
spent
true